Web19 dec. 2024 · Dijkstra Algorithm is a graph algorithm for finding the shortest path from a source node to all other nodes in a graph (single source shortest path). It is a type of greedy algorithm. It only works on weighted graphs with positive weights. It has a time complexity of O (V^2) O(V 2) using the adjacency matrix representation of graph. Web16 nov. 2015 · When you move the real object in the heap, you update the position in this object. To call decrease-priority you pass this object so you can go right to the position in the heap and bubble up the element if necessary. In this way it's O (log (n)). In fact finding the element is O (1) and restoring the heap property is O (log (n)). P.s. Web28 sep. 2024 · 1 Answer. Ok O (1) is only for retrieving the root of the heap. To delete this root, all heap implementations have a O (log (n)) time complexity. For example the …
